A generator is one of the best investments you can make to protect your home during a power outage. But before buying one, it’s important to choose the right size. A generator that’s too small won’t power the essentials, while one that’s too large may be costly and unnecessary. Here are some tips to help you choose the right size generator for your home.
List Your Essential Appliances
Start by making a list of the appliances you’ll need during an outage. Common items include refrigerators, freezers, lights, fans, and medical equipment. Some families may also want to power air conditioners, water heaters, or sump pumps. Knowing your priorities helps you decide how much power you really need.
Understand Wattage Needs
Every appliance uses a certain number of watts. Check the labels on your appliances or the owner’s manual to find this number. Add up the wattage of all the items you plan to run at the same time. This total gives you a good idea of how powerful your generator should be.
Factor in Starting Watts
Some appliances, like refrigerators or air conditioners, need extra power when they first turn on. This is called starting watts. Be sure to account for this when calculating your total. A generator should have enough capacity to handle both running watts and starting watts.
Small vs. Large Generators
If you only need to power a few essentials, a small portable generator might be enough. These are easier to move and cost less. For whole-house coverage, a larger generator or standby unit may be a better choice. While they are more expensive, they can power almost everything in your home at once.
Safety and Professional Guidance
Choosing the right size is not only about comfort — it’s also about safety. Using an undersized generator can damage appliances, while oversizing can waste fuel. Working with a professional ensures you get a generator that matches your exact needs.
